Eating Disorders
Mental disorders defined by abnormal eating habits that negatively affect a person's physical or mental health.
Childhood Sexual Abuse
A form of sexual abuse involving a child and an older person, often resulting in long-term psychological and emotional impact.
Weight Restoration
The process of gaining back weight lost due to an illness or eating disorder, aiming to return to a healthy weight for recovery.
Anorexics
Individuals suffering from anorexia nervosa, an eating disorder characterized by an obsessive fear of gaining weight and severely restricted food intake.
